
Field of Screams MT Celebrates 26 Years in Victor
If you’ve been craving that first good scare of the season, it’s here. The Field of Screams in Victor is marking its 26th season of making Montanans scream, jump, and occasionally buy clean undies from the concession stand. It’s the Bitterroot Valley’s longest-running Halloween tradition, and it’s back bigger and scarier than ever.
Creepin It REAL!
At night, the corn maze becomes pure terror. Things go bump in the stalks, chainsaws and screams echo, and the shiny new Gateway Manor that is now DOUBLE the size. You’ll stumble through foggy corn hedges, dodge deranged clowns, and wonder why you ever signed up in the first place. It’s Montana’s number one haunted attraction for a reason.
Family Friendly by Day
Of course, not everyone is looking for maximum heart rates. By day, the Field of Screams dials it back for families. Think hayrides, pumpkin patches, photo ops, and the PlaHAYground for kids. Mondays even feature “Zombie Free Nights,” where you can explore without jump scares or haunters leaping out of the corn.
